    Time for the weekly(?) update:

    34007 on service trains. 92212 on special train - REMEMBER IT NOW FACES NORTH

    76017 is split. Tender is outside in the yard. Loco in the main workshops. Work continues on it and the mechanical half of the team dont have a restoration project underway.

    850 Lord Nelson is in wheeldrop. Trying to drop the trailing driving axle. But dismantling is taking longer than expected. And also, much of the front running plates and smoke deflectors have been taken off.

    31806 is due to have its boiler taken out of the boiler shop next tuesday and put on scaffolding outside, ready for preparations for testing. Smokebox door mechanisms now in place, and door back on.

    MK1 TSO is halfway through painting, in undercoat. the class 11 shunter has finally come in for repairs and a repaint, still showing a 'thomas face' (which are still scattered all over the yard).

    31806's tender has started to be lined out, looking good.

    Thomas is looking weary, but ready to go out to other railways, it is anticipated its after its withdrawal at the end of august should take about 8 months.

    34007 was hauling a 3 coach train, reminiscent of the west country trains, on learner driver experience.

    Thats all i think, things are a happening.
